Network Integrity Mechanisms
Network integrity mechanisms are the collective protocols and practices that ensure the correctness and security of a blockchain network. This includes the consensus algorithms that validate transactions, as well as the rules that prevent double-spending and unauthorized modifications.
In a derivatives context, these mechanisms ensure that margin calculations are accurate and that positions are settled correctly. They protect the network from technical failures and malicious actors.
By maintaining a high standard of integrity, the network builds the trust necessary for large-scale financial activity. These mechanisms are the core technical foundation upon which all other financial applications are built.
